Solid carbide end mills are high-stiffness cutting tools made from a tungsten carbide matrix with a cobalt binder, engineered for high-speed, high-precision machining in automotive and industrial production. In Canada they are popular across automotive, aerospace, energy, and subcontract manufacturing because they deliver excellent wear resistance, sustained edge life, and the ability to hold tight tolerances in aluminum, steel, and exotic alloys. Buyers in Canada prioritize repeatable surface finish, predictable tool life, and compatibility with modern CNC and high-feed processes. Other preferences include advanced coatings for heat resistance, variable-geometry flute designs for chip control, and options for through-coolant delivery to support dry or minimal-lubricant machining practices that reduce cost and environmental impact.

What Research and Testing Say About Solid Carbide End Mills

Laboratory studies and industry tests have consistently shown why solid carbide end mills are a top choice for precision production. The inherent stiffness and hardness of carbide permit higher cutting speeds and improved dimensional stability compared with high speed steel. Coatings such as AlTiN and TiCN improve hot hardness and reduce adhesion when machining aluminum and high-temperature alloys. Tool geometry, including variable helix and optimized flute count, plays a major role in chip evacuation, vibration reduction, and surface finish. Emerging cooling strategies, like cryogenic cooling and minimal quantity lubrication, also show reliable gains in tool life and part quality for demanding alloys.

→

Material science: Tungsten carbide with cobalt binder provides a balance of hardness and toughness that supports high-speed milling and consistent dimensional control.

→

Coatings: Research and supplier tests indicate coated carbide tools resist thermal degradation and extend cutting life, particularly in dry or high-temperature milling.

→

Geometry effects: Variable helix and optimized flute designs reduce chatter, improve chip evacuation, and enhance surface finish in aluminum and steel.

→

Machining strategies: High-speed milling and proper toolholding reduce deflection, allowing carbide tools to produce tighter tolerances at higher material removal rates.

→

Sustainability and cost: Studies on MQL and cryogenic methods show reduced coolant use and lower total cost per part while maintaining or improving tool life.
